Net-Base Delphi

Delphi за корпоративни приложения

Delphi да се използва целенасочено за бизнес логика, продуктивни десктоп процеси и контролирани мултиплатформени стратегии.

Delphi. Доменна логика. Десктоп.

Delphi за корпоративни приложения, които се нуждаят от бизнес логика, продукционни клиенти и ясно дефинирано по-нататъшно развитие.

Бизнес логика Работен плот Отчети Мултиплатформен

Доменна логика, близка до ежедневието

Утвърдените правила, потребителските интерфейси и пътищата на данните могат да бъдат структурирано пренесени, вместо да бъдат лекомислено отхвърлени.

Продуктивни настолни процеси

Таблиците, печатът, отчетите и локалните интеграции остават силни там, където реалните работни процеси наистина имат значение.

Модернизация с мярка

Delphi става част от чиста целева архитектура, вместо да се третира като наследено бреме или догма.

Технологичен профил

Delphi за корпоративни приложения — преглед

Delphi за нас не е носталгично придържане към остаряла платформа, а умишлено използван инструмент за корпоративни приложения, които трябва да работят стабилно в ежедневието. Особено там, където години наред натрупаната бизнес логика, сложните десктоп процеси, отчети, близостта до базата данни и контролируемата производителност имат значение, Delphi остава и до днес изключително силен.

История

От RAD към надежден корпоративен софтуер

Delphi рано показа силата си в бързото изграждане на продуктивни десктоп приложения. В много компании това не бе само бърз GUI, а през годините се оформи стабилна предметна основа с реални процеси, правила и изключения.

Днес

Силен, когато бизнес логиката и десктопът действително имат значение

Delphi разгършва силите си там, където потребителите имат нужда от продуктивни клиенти: таблици, отчети, локални интеграции, печат, близост до базата данни и плавни интерфейси за реални работни потоци.

Стратегия

Не всичко да се подменя, а да се пренесе разумно от предметна гледна точка

Особено в натрупани системи Delphi често е мястото, където живее самото предметно съдържание. Затова ние не модернизираме Delphi безразборно, а пренареждаме логиката, достъпа до данни и архитектурата чисто и целенасочено.

Защо Delphi остава устойчив в корпоративните приложения толкова дълго

Delphi стана важен в много компании не защото е бил модерен, а защото в продължение на години е решавал продуктивни проблеми. От това в много приложения възниква плътност на предметната логика, която не се пренаписва лекомислено. Цени, правила, отчети, проверки за валидност, разпечатки, специални случаи и потребителски пътеки често не са залегнали в предметна спецификация, а в самото работещо приложение.

Технически особено релевантна е близостта между бизнес логиката, модела на данните и продуктивния клиент. Delphi е силен, когато голяма част от предметната функционалност е директно видима в използваеми десктоп процеси. Това важи особено за системи, в които скоростта, близостта до данните, ясните клавишни пътеки, печатът и спокоен работен поток имат по-голямо значение от чисто уеб-центриран интерфейс.

Затова за нас Delphi често е ядрото на архитектурата, а не нейното препятствие. Въпросът не е дали Delphi съществува, а дали приложението е добре разслоено. Когато достъпът до данни, бизнес логиката и интерфейсът се отделят един от друг, Delphi може да се модернизира контролирано, да се направи мултиплатформено и чисто да се комбинира с REST-сървъри и услуги.

Силни страни, ограничения и целесъобразно приложение

Къде Delphi е силен

Delphi е силен при продуктивни десктоп корпоративни приложения, процеси с близост до базата данни, отчети, ясни потребителски потоци и там, където споделена предметна база за няколко клиентски цели е целесъобразна.

Къде е уместно да се комбинира

Когато на преден план са портали, APIs, облачно-ориентирани услуги или сервизно-ориентирани интеграции, комбинация с C# или отделни сървърни компоненти често е по-добро архитектурно решение от един всеобхватен подход.

Кои слабости трябва да се признаят честно

Delphi става проблематичен, когато стари системи са силно монолитно развити, прекалено много предметна логика е поставена в UI или екипите разрешават въпроси за билд, deployment и библиотеки твърде късно. Именно затова архитектурният разрез има по-голямо значение от модния лозунг.

Как днес разглеждаме Delphi

Ние използваме Delphi там, където то по предметно ниво действително носи стойност: за продуктивни клиенти, за натрупана предметна субстанция и за приложения, които се оценяват не по модни смени на платформи, а по стабилна използваемост и чисто по-нататъшно развитие. Именно от това често възниква много икономична комбинация от запазване на субстанцията и модерна техническа подредба.

Ако проектът трябва основно да работи върху няколко десктоп цели, ние продължаваме тази линия на страницата Delphi Multiplattform. Когато става въпрос за техническо обновяване на един съществуващ софтуерен фонд, следващата стъпка обикновено е Delphi-Modernisierung. В двата случая Delphi за нас не е отживелица, а градивен елемент на чиста целева архитектура.

FAQ относно Delphi за корпоративни приложения

При Delphi в предприятията рядко става дума за носталгия, по-скоро за въпроса как натрупаната предметна логика, десктоп процесите и няколко целеви платформи да бъдат икономично и коректно поддържани и развивани.

Защо днес все още целенасочено залагате на Delphi?

Защото Delphi в много корпоративни приложения предлага силна комбинация от натрупана бизнес-логика, производителни десктоп процеси, близост до базата данни и контролируемо по-нататъшно развитие.

Подходящ ли е Delphi само за модернизация на съществуващи системи?

Не. Delphi е също подходящ и за нови корпоративни приложения, когато продуктивни десктоп процеси, отчети, локална интеграция и споделена предметна база за няколко платформи са важни.

Къде са границите на Delphi?

Особено там, където един проект е предимно портално-, сервизно- или облачно-центриран. В такива случаи ние умишлено комбинираме Delphi с C#, REST-сървъри или уеб-компоненти, вместо да се опитваме да натъпчем всичко в един инструмент.

Прегледайте събраните допълнителни въпроси

Тези кратки отговори остават тук на страницата. На централната FAQ-лендингстраница ние допълнително поставяме темата в контекста на архитектура, модернизация, платформи и експлоатация.

Към FAQ-лендинг страницата с по-задълбочени отговори